Output 5265a3f8d0ba217af908041b7953225a4460c17533e043e2f00f1bd2c127dace:8

value
551583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9845cde26fdab844193827bab5f362ed1ec998df OP_EQUAL
address
3FaAFnWAyiPA7mWBAhc7LaHMfSGZ7ZVqfg
transaction
5265a3f8d0ba217af908041b7953225a4460c17533e043e2f00f1bd2c127dace
spent
true